This is a different game which is painless but brings about some entertaining photos. The game requires putting on red lipstick on all the men and generating them stand in a line. The game is to pass the seaweed along the line using only their mouths. This game can be repeated producing the size of the seaweed smaller and smaller sized till they pass or till a single of them drops it. If they do happen to drop it, the bridesmaids can come up with intriguing punishments for them. The objective of this game is for the groomsmen to perform together and prove their bonding. With the added lipsticks, it can also be embarrassing for them generating the photographs comical.

On the wedding night, the room of the bride and the groom will be lit with a dragon and phoenix candle. Correct soon after this, the newlywed couple will drink wine from two glasses or cups that are tied with a red string. To commence with, one particular of the most common Chinese wedding traditions that are also incorporated in western weddings in Canada is the picking of the wedding date. The date is cautiously picked according to the birth dates and the astrological signs of the bride and the groom. The ceremony too commences at the half hour, in an attempt to assure good fortune for the couple. Night, just just before the wedding, the bride will have to be bathed in water influenced by citrus.

The preferred form of gifts is the red packet, otherwise known as hongpao or laisee. The giver puts cash into red packets, usually bearing auspicious Chinese words. The parents and relatives give laisee to the couple in the course of the tea ceremony. Invited guests to the wedding banquet are anticipated to give laisee as well.

A different custom that most of the contemporary brides stick to is the changing of costumes. The brides are commonly required to adjust in 3 different attires throughout the entire night, just before the wedding. These dresses contain the conventional white dress for the wedding, a bridal dress for the tea ceremony and finally a sleek cocktail dress to greet the guests. The headpiece worn by the bride is a phoenix crown which is crafted from the feathers of kingfisher and pearl. This is accomplished in order to safeguard her from the heaves till she finally reaches the household of the groom. The groom here commonly wears a royal blue dragon robe along with a black coat and a black headpiece.
